I am currently running my OS on a 250GB Samsung 840 Pro. It is running on a Dual Xeon 2630 v3 procs. The mainboard is the Asus Z10PA-D8.

Can I boot Windows 10 from a Add-in-card that houses NVMe/Optane SSDs on this mainboard or do I need to update mainboard's BIOS firmware (if they have any) in order for it to detect and boot from such aic drives? Or it doesnt matter?

older mobos will not boot with nvme main drives without bios update to allow compatability

you can only use it as secondary storage if there is no bios update
